>>For some reason, a similar Imperial was offered in 1968, but I believe
that they decided to call it a Crown Sedan. At that point, we were back to
all Crowns and LeBarons again, until the Crowns finally went away, and all
that was left were LeBarons.
Paul W.
Paul,
The base 68, only available as a sedan, was also simply an Imperial. No
other designation. I have seen one, at Carlisle, and I think there is a 68
sedan owner on this list. It still appears to be a wonderful automobile.
The Crowns were either hardtops or convertibles.
